Output ea0659784edbfb55291e25fb76977977a31fefea2fb812c8535717fe83e609aa:0

value
4418515311
script pubkey
OP_0 OP_PUSHBYTES_20 8511e7d4fee3bb2aa0dfa24958ef814b46b2e3d8
address
tb1qs5g70487uwaj4gxl5fy43mupfdrt9c7cf5hrq7
transaction
ea0659784edbfb55291e25fb76977977a31fefea2fb812c8535717fe83e609aa